2 sauna sessions each week for 3 months each long lasting 15 minutes was related to reduced sperm matter and motility. Nevertheless, these effects were short-lived. Dr. Ashish Sharma, a board-certified internal medication physician and hospitalist at Yuma Regional Medical Facility, also shared understanding relating to unfavorable adverse effects connected to sauna use.
Sharma claims the dry heat created in an infrared sauna can cause you to end up being overheated, and if used for an extended session, it can likewise trigger dehydration and also warmth exhaustion or warmth stroke. According to specialists, sauna use is taken into consideration safe for lots of people. Yet it's still an excellent concept to talk with your physician before attempting it.
These include: Medical experts additionally suggest staying clear of sauna usage throughout maternity. Generally, if you're taking drug, have actually implanted clinical devices, or have a clinical condition whether severe or long-term it's finest to wage caution. Cook-Bolden claims you ought to talk with your medical professional prior to coming across any type of extreme warmth exposure.
If you have a neurological shortages, Cook-Bolden claims your capacity to sense and respond to the intensity of warmth could put reference you in jeopardy for warm or melt injuries. If you're expectant, avoid using the sauna unless you've gotten clearance page from your medical professional. Older grownups are more prone to dehydration and lightheadedness with dry warm, which can cause drops.

Whether you're making use of an infrared sauna at a health and wellness club, day spa, or in your home, it is necessary to adhere to basic standards for secure usage. Here are some tips to obtain you started.
This is especially real if you have any type of wellness problems. "Due to its dehydrating nature, it's finest to avoid alcohol intake in advance," claims Cook-Bolden. It's crucial to stay hydrated when making use of a sauna.
If the facility allows it, you can consider alcohol consumption water while you're in the sauna also. An older 1991 review recommends setting brief time limitations for sauna use. Individuals who are extra likely to experience damaging results, such as older grownups, may wish to stick to 5 to 10 minute sessions.
If you have a delicate skin problem or a condition such as eczema than can trigger skin inflammation, Cook-Bolden states you might intend to permit your skin to recover before exposure. If you experience signs of lightheadedness or light-headedness, stop your session quickly. Sharma says this can be a sign of dehydration or other medical problems.
